前言
随着前端技术的不断发展,现在的前端项目已经变得越来越庞大复杂。随着代码的增加,维护和管理变得越来越困难,因此,很多前端开发者开始将项目分为不同的模块和组件,以方便管理项目。
而使用模板引擎是管理项目的一种很有效的方式。这里我们将介绍如何使用 npm 包 @appfibre/rollup-plugin-jst 来使用模板引擎。
基本介绍
@appfibre/rollup-plugin-jst 是 Rollup 的插件,它使用 Underscore.js 和 lodash.template 来编译模板,并将其转换为模块。
使用步骤
第一步:安装依赖
首先我们需要安装依赖,使用 npm 安装 @appfibre/rollup-plugin-jst:
--- ------- ---------------------------
第二步:配置 Rollup
在 Rollup 的配置文件中,我们需要添加 @appfibre/rollup-plugin-jst。例如:
------ --- ---- ------------------------------ ------ ------- - ------ --------------- ------- - ----- ----------------- ------- ----- -- -------- -------- --
第三步:创建模板
我们需要创建一个包含变量的 Underscore.js / Lodash 模板。例如:
----- ------- ----- ------- ------ ------- ------ ------
第四步:使用模板
我们需要使用模板并传递必要的变量。例如:
------ --- ---- ------------------ ----- ------ - ----- ------ -------- -------- ------- --- ------------------------------------------- - -------
第五步:打包
运行 Rollup 打包命令即可得到输出:
------ --
结论
使用 npm 包 @appfibre/rollup-plugin-jst 教程至此结束。我们介绍了如何使用 Rollup 和 @appfibre/rollup-plugin-jst 来编译模板,并将其转换为可用的模块。模板引擎是管理大型项目的一种很有效的方式,可以大量减少重复的代码和提高代码的可读性。我们希望这篇文章能帮助你更好地管理你的前端项目。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/110591